Friend and I fished a beautiful Sunday afternoon, sunny with a high of 80 with a slight breeze after a cool morning. So the weather was perfect and we got what we came for. Friend caught a 6.5 (his largest bass) and I caught an 8 (24 inches) my largest so far in Private Waters. 

Mine jumped out of the water twice by the boat - wow. I couldn't stop him/her from getting into the timber. Friends really got tangled in the tress, we were fortunate to get them out. Both had huge heads so they have plenty of room to grow. Both were caught on deep diving cranks in the channel, thanks Steve for tip posted earlier. We harvested two others.  Suggest they remove foot controlled trolling motor as it just gets in the way and makes the boat heavier so harder to launch.
